Under Article 288 of the Treaty on the Functioning of the European Union, a decision is binding in its entirety. A decision may be a legislative or a non-legislative act. Decisions are legislative acts when they are adopted jointly by: the European Parliament and the Council under the ordinary legislative procedure, or.
A decision is legally binding act in its entirety. Unless explicitly stated otherwise, a decision is binding for the EU as a whole. Decisions can address specific legal entities, in which case a decision is binding only to them.
The Official Journal of the European Union is the official publication (gazette) for EU legal acts, other acts and official information from EU institutions, bodies, offices and agencies.
Council resolutions usually set out future work foreseen in a specific policy area. They have no legal effect but they can invite the Commission to make a proposal or take further action.
Decisions. A "decision" is binding on those to whom it is addressed (e.g. an EU country or an individual company) and is directly applicable. For example, the Council issued a decision on allowing Croatia to adopt the euro on 1 January 2023.

A Tax Commission Decision is a formal ruling made by a tax authority regarding tax-related issues, which may involve disputes over tax assessments, liabilities, or compliance requirements.
Individuals or entities involved in tax disputes or those seeking a ruling from the tax authority regarding their tax situation are typically required to file a Tax Commission Decision.
To fill out a Tax Commission Decision, one must complete the designated form provided by the tax authority, ensuring all relevant information, supporting documents, and evidence related to the tax issue in question are included.
The purpose of a Tax Commission Decision is to offer a resolution to tax disputes, provide clarity on tax obligations, and ensure fair application of tax laws.
Information that must be reported includes the taxpayer's identification details, nature of the dispute, relevant tax years, evidence supporting the case, and the specific tax issues being challenged.
